I had the pleasure of knowing Dr. Campbell through my work in the emergency room at our local hospial (where I had my wls). She is a very caring person who trained in Boston. Asked the right questions -- and had the right answers for me. I am pleased with the care I received from her and the staff when I had my visits. The referrals to psych and nutritionist were accomplished quickly and I was left knowing that if I have any questions or concerns she is there at any time to assist me. There is strong precare with a physician, nurse coordinator, psych, nutritionist and surgeon -- and strong aftercare as well.
I had confidence about having the laprascopic rny done with Dr. Campbell -- and I honestly do not have anything bad to say about her. She far exceeded my expectations, and she did a wonderful job.
